The Master of Arts in Education/Adult Education and Training (MAEd/AET) is a non-licensure, business-minded degree with a foundation of educational theory and practice. The MAEd/AET prepares individuals to train and educate adults and build educational programs that engage adult learners using a variety of delivery formats.Salary for Adult Educators. Adult education can be a personally fulfilling career path, and it can also help you earn a reliable income. According to the Bureau of Labor Statistics, some careers in the adult education field include: Postsecondary teacher: $80,790 per year. Instructional coordinator: $66,970 per year.

The Master of Teaching (Secondary) from the University of the Sunshine Coast is for graduates with non-Education bachelor degrees who want to qualify to teach their disciplines in secondary schools. Master / Full-time, Part-time / Blended. University of the Sunshine Coast Buderim, Australia.The Master of Education, on the other hand, focuses on the process and practice of education. It focuses less on the practical and more on the theoretical and philosophical. It is often conferred for educators ...Two degrees with names that on face value appear to be the same are the Master's in Teaching- also known as Master in the Art of Teaching (MAT) and the Master of Education (M.Ed.). If a teacher's goal is to become more competent in the pedagogy and practical skills of teaching, then the MAT route may be the best choice.
